๐ŸŒฟ What is an ESG ETF?

An ESG ETF (Environmental, Social, and Governance Exchange-Traded Fund) is a collection of stocks or bonds from companies that meet specific criteria in areas like:

๐ŸŒ Environmental: Sustainability, carbon footprint, climate change policies

๐Ÿ‘ฅ Social: Labor practices, diversity, community impact

๐Ÿง‘โ€โš–๏ธ Governance: Board diversity, executive pay, transparency

These ETFs are designed to let you invest in companies that are doing goodโ€”without sacrificing returns.

๐Ÿ” Top 5 ESG ETFs for U.S. Millennials in 2025

Letโ€™s explore the best performing, low-cost, high-impact ESG ETFs that Millennials are pouring money into:

๐ŸŒฑ 1. iShares ESG Aware MSCI USA ETF (ESGU)

Assets: $26B+

Expense Ratio: 0.15%

Holdings: Apple, Microsoft, NVIDIA

Why Millennials Love It: Big-name tech + sustainable filter๐Ÿ”— Invest via Fidelity

๐ŸŒฟ 2. Vanguard ESG U.S. Stock ETF (ESGV)

Assets: $9B+

Expense Ratio: 0.09%

Holdings: Tesla, Home Depot, Visa

Why Millennials Love It: Low cost + Vanguard trust

๐Ÿ’ก 3. SPDR S&P 500 ESG ETF (EFIV)

Assets: $2.2B

Expense Ratio: 0.10%

Holdings: Meta, Google, J&J

Why Millennials Love It: ESG exposure to S&P 500 leaders

๐Ÿ“˜ 4. iShares MSCI Global Impact ETF (SDG)

Assets: $650M

Expense Ratio: 0.49%

Holdings: Global companies tackling UN Sustainable Goals

Why Millennials Love It: Impact beyond U.S. borders

๐Ÿงฐ How to Start Investing in ESG ETFs (Step-by-Step)

Want to jump in? Hereโ€™s how to get started today:

โœ… Step 1: Choose a Trusted Platform

Use a reputable brokerage that offers commission-free trades and ESG fund filters.

โœ… Step 2: Define Your Values

Are you focused on environmental protection? Corporate ethics? Women-led companies? Choose funds that reflect your beliefs.

โœ… Step 3: Diversify

Donโ€™t invest all in one ETF. Pick a mix across different sectors and geographies.

โœ… Step 4: Set and Forget (or Rebalance Quarterly)

Use automated tools to stay on track and avoid overexposure.

โœ… Step 5: Use Tax-Advantaged Accounts

Hold your ESG ETFs in Roth IRAs or 401(k)s for better tax efficiency.
